Combat Aircraft by Country (Africa)
Overview
Combat aircraft form the backbone of modern air power, providing air superiority, ground attack, and strategic strike capabilities. This ranking compares countries by their total inventory of fighter jets, multirole aircraft, and interceptors. Nations with larger combat fleets can project power across greater distances and maintain sustained air operations during conflicts.

| # | Country | Total | |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| ๐ช๐ฌ Egypt | 545 | |
| 2 | ๐ฉ๐ฟ Algeria | 145 | |
| 3 | ๐ฒ๐ฆ Morocco | 117 | |
| 4 | ๐ฆ๐ด Angola | 95 | |
| 5 | ๐ธ๐ฉ Sudan | 82 | |
| 6 | ๐ช๐น Ethiopia | 32 | |
| 7 | ๐ณ๐ฌ Nigeria | 26 | |
| 8 | ๐ณ๐ฆ Namibia | 24 | |
| 9 | ๐ฐ๐ช Kenya | 23 | |
| 10 | ๐ฑ๐พ Libya | 23 | |
| 11 | ๐ฟ๐ผ Zimbabwe | 22 | |
| 12 | ๐ง๐ผ Botswana | 15 | |
| 13 | ๐ฟ๐ฒ Zambia | 15 | |
| 14 | ๐น๐ฟ Tanzania | 14 | |
| 15 | ๐น๐ณ Tunisia | 13 | |
| 16 | ๐ฒ๐ฑ Mali | 9 | |
| 17 | ๐น๐ฉ Chad | 9 | |
| 18 | ๐ฒ๐ฟ Mozambique | 8 | |
| 19 | ๐จ๐ฉ Congo Democratic Republic | 6 | |
| 20 | ๐ฌ๐ฆ Gabon | 6 | |
| 21 | ๐บ๐ฌ Uganda | 6 | |
| 22 | ๐น๐ฌ Togo | 5 | |
| 23 | ๐ฟ๐ฆ South Africa | 5 | |
| 24 | ๐ฌ๐ญ Ghana | 4 | |
| 25 | ๐จ๐ฎ Ivory Coast | 2 | |
| 26 | ๐จ๐ฌ Congo | 2 | |
| 27 | ๐ฌ๐ถ Equatorial Guinea | 2 | |
| 28 | ๐ณ๐ช Niger | 2 | |
| 29 | ๐ช๐ท Eritrea | 1 |
